Based on the dynamic behavior of IGBT and diode, this paper proposed an experimental method for extracting stray inductance of bus bars without high bandwidth current measurement. The experiment is implemented by a double pulse test of the 4.5kV/3000A HVIGBTs. The stray inductance extraction results of several methods were analyzed and compared, verifying the accuracy of the proposed method.

1700V SiC modules were built with next-generation SiC MOSFETs, with 25°C RDSON per MOSFET cut approximately 50% from existing commercial SiC MOSFETs. Additionally, the external SiC anti-parallel diode was eliminated in favor of using the SiC MOSFET body diode during the dead time.
